I am trying to unlock my final steam achievement (Magazine addict).

In short I missed both Occult 3 and 4 on my playthrough, I then rebooted to get 4 and played through to the area where you get Ragnarok, only to find out 3 is also missable.....

I really dont want to play through the game from the Galbadia missile launch again.  However when I use Hyne to edit my save file to include the occult fan magazines the achievement does not trigger.

Is there any way to hack a game save to get this achievement?

I'd guess that function which checks the achievement is executed while you pick up an item. Not many devs make achievements retroactive. Try looking for Cheat Engine table for FF8, there's a possibility to give yourself items at runtime, which just might trigger your check.
